Output 99966d90cd4df875e740e85e1a761e6e161fa705af2156c5dfc19afe0ba5ddea:0

value
833274649
script pubkey
OP_0 OP_PUSHBYTES_20 ce50206bd840e9581f27e93bd7aba36fae090ee1
address
bc1qeegzq67cgr54s8e8ayaa02ard7hqjrhpywrwn7
transaction
99966d90cd4df875e740e85e1a761e6e161fa705af2156c5dfc19afe0ba5ddea
confirmations
190522
spent
true